Transaction 2113ea90b1522c34b203d4c4e2cf719c2271713d518e244236d682359c988920

4 Input
2 Outputs
  • 2113ea90b1522c34b203d4c4e2cf719c2271713d518e244236d682359c988920:0
  • value  3696
    address  18g1YsR1yJ46p2FmMoJPApQL4zGmLBtWrx
  • 2113ea90b1522c34b203d4c4e2cf719c2271713d518e244236d682359c988920:1
  • value  613665
    address  3HpRs7kW6W5b3VgsGGmSURxjr3zxdPuETm